Ascension Lutheran Early Childhood Center (ALECC) is looking for a warm, nurturing, and dependable Infant Teacher to join our team for a temporary maternity leave position. This is a full-time, Monday–Friday position beginning in October 2026 and continuing through approximately March 2027.

Our Infant Teachers play an important role in creating a safe, loving, and engaging environment where our youngest children can learn, grow, and feel secure. We are looking for someone who genuinely enjoys working with infants and understands the importance of responsive, attentive care during these early years.

Responsibilities include:

  • Providing loving, attentive, and developmentally appropriate care for infants
  • Creating a safe, nurturing, and engaging classroom environment
  • Following individual feeding, sleeping, and care routines
  • Supporting infants’ social, emotional, physical, and cognitive development
  • Communicating regularly and positively with families
  • Working collaboratively with co-teachers and other members of our teaching team
  • Maintaining a clean, organized, and welcoming classroom
  • Following all ALECC policies, procedures, and licensing requirements
We are looking for someone who:

  • Has experience working with infants or young children
  • Is patient, dependable, nurturing, and energetic
  • Enjoys working as part of a team
  • Communicates professionally and effectively with families and coworkers
  • Is committed to providing high-quality care and creating meaningful relationships with children
